Throughout 2024, we have analysed important developments and innovation spanning all areas of the telecoms industry and wider digital ecosystem. How will the industry evolve in 2025? Which trends will continue to run their course? Which trends will take a new direction? And which will enter the fray for the first time?
To help navigate the year ahead, we are releasing a series of reports that highlight the key trends to watch in 2025 and the implications for ecosystem players. The analysis covers five key areas: 5G and network transformation; spectrum; IoT and the wider enterprise market; the digital consumer; and fixed and pay-TV markets. This Insight Spotlight addresses IoT and the wider enterprise market.

IoT market forecast to 2035: connections by region and vertical
The global IoT market will reach 40.8 billion connections by 2030, growing at 8% CAGR during 2023-2030, and is forecast to expand further to 52.9 billion connections by 2035 at a moderated CAGR of 5% during 2030–2035. Enterprise IoT will drive the market, with the share of enterprise IoT connections expanding from 65% in 2030 to 69% by 2035, led by smart buildings (15% CAGR to 2030), smart manufacturing (12%) and smart utilities (10%). The forecast includes annual connections data through to 2035, with regional and vertical breakdowns.
IoT for digital industries: what shapes enterprise priorities, expectations and investment plans
Digital transformation of enterprises is accelerating across all vertical sectors, with IoT being an important driver and enabler. GSMA Intelligence surveyed 5,320 enterprises across 32 countries and 10 vertical sectors to gain relevant insights into their digital transformation across a range of technologies. This report analyses the key findings and implications for IoT.
